Fixed two critical issues with email notifications: 1. Test email API now returns errors properly instead of always showing success 2. Added timeouts to SMTP connections to prevent hanging (10s dial, 30s overall) The root cause of users not receiving emails was that errors were being silently logged instead of returned to the API, making it appear successful when it wasn't. SMTP connections could also hang indefinitely on unreachable servers. Note: API uses "server" and "port" JSON fields, not "smtpHost"/"smtpPort"
